If m(x) =x+5/x-1 and n(x) = x - 3, which function has the same domain as (mºn)(x)?

Respuesta :

tomson1975
tomson1975 tomson1975
  • 18-08-2020

We have

M(X) = (X + 5)/(X - 1)

N(X) = X - 3

So,

M(N(X)) =  [(X - 3) + 5]/[(X - 3) - 1]

M(N(X)) =  [X + 2]/[X - 4]

The M(N(X)) domain will be:

D = {X / X ≠ 4}

4 ∉ to the M(N(X)) domain, otherwise we would have a/0, which is not possible (a denominator with zero). An equivalent function would be

H(X) = 1/(X - 4)
